摘要:本教程详细介绍了最新微信小程序的开发过程。从注册小程序账号、开发环境搭建、设计界面布局、编写代码逻辑,到测试发布等各个环节,提供了全面的指导。本教程注重实战操作,旨在帮助开发者快速掌握微信小程序的开发技巧,顺利开发出功能完善、用户体验良好的小程序。跟随本教程,零基础开发者也能轻松上手微信小程序开发。
随着移动互联网的飞速发展,微信小程序已经变成企业与个人推广服务的重要平台,本教程将为你提供微信小程序的开发流程、技术要点和最佳实践的详细介绍,帮助你快速掌握微信小程序开发的核心技能。
准备工作
1、注册小程序账号:在微信公众平台完成注册及认证流程。
2、搭建开发环境:安装微信开发者工具,配置必要的开发环境。
3、基础知识储备:熟悉小程序的基本架构、页面生命周期、数据通信等基础知识。
小程序开发教程
1、创建小程序项目
(1) 在微信开发者工具中创建新项目,填写必要信息。
(2) 配置项目信息,包括App.json、App.config等核心文件。
(3) 熟悉项目结构,了解各文件的作用。
2、开发小程序界面
(1) 界面布局设计:使用WXML和WXSS进行界面设计和布局。
(2) 交互功能实现:利用小程序提供的组件和API,实现界面交互效果。
(3) 用户体验优化:关注界面美观、加载速度、响应速度等,提升用户体验。
3、实现业务逻辑
(1) 掌握小程序的数据通信机制,包括数据绑定、事件处理等关键技术。
(2) 根据业务需求,编写功能逻辑代码,如网络请求、数据处理等。
(3) 关注性能优化,提高小程序运行效率。
4、调试与测试
(1) 在开发者工具中进行调试,检查代码错误和性能问题。
(2) 进行功能测试,确保小程序功能正常、稳定。
(3) 进行用户体验测试,提高用户满意度。
5、发布与运营
(1) 提交审核:完成开发后,提交小程序至微信审核。
(2) 发布上线:审核通过后,发布小程序至微信平台。
(3) 数据分析与优化:关注数据表现,根据情况进行优化改进。
技术要点详解
1、WXML与WXSS基础:学习并掌握WXML和WXSS的基础语法,用于界面布局和样式设计。
2、小程序组件:熟悉各类小程序组件,如按钮、表单、导航等,丰富界面交互。
3、数据通信:掌握小程序的数据通信机制,实现业务逻辑功能。
4、生命周期与状态管理:了解页面和App生命周期,合理管理应用状态。
5、性能优化:关注界面渲染、数据加载、代码优化等方面的性能问题。
最佳实践
1、遵循设计规范:遵循微信小程序的设计规范,提高易用性和美观度。
2、合理使用组件:根据业务需求合理使用组件,提高开发效率。
3、关注用户体验:始终关注用户体验,提供流畅的操作体验。
4、数据驱动开发:以数据为中心,实现小程序的动态化和个性化。
5、迭代与优化:持续关注数据表现和用户反馈,进行持续的迭代和优化。
本教程为你提供了全面的微信小程序开发教程,帮助你快速掌握微信小程序开发的核心技能,随着技术的不断进步和行业的持续发展,微信小程序将会有更多的应用场景和功能,为了更好地适应行业发展和满足用户需求,建议你持续关注行业动态和技术趋势,不断提升自己的技能水平。
还没有评论,来说两句吧...